## Idempotency Keys for Payment Retries (Lumopay)

Every retry of a charge request must reuse the original idempotency key; generating a new key on retry can produce duplicate charges. Keys are scoped per merchant and expire after 48 hours. Reviewers should verify keys are derived server-side, never from client input. The full key-generation specification and threat model are maintained on the internal page.

dashboard of kaguf-tawip = https://vault.merlaqsys.test/issue

Handover note — Facilities desk, Greywater Yard site

For Annika, taking over from Stefan. Bike cage: the north latch is stiff; lift slightly before swiping, otherwise the reader errors out. Contractor from Kestrel Door Services is booked for Thursday to service it. Parking gates: the exit gate sensor misses small cars — wave a badge at the pillar reader instead. Log any gate faults in the yellow binder, not the ticket system. Both the cage and the gate keypads now share the updated code below.

staff pass of kawip-hawef = bdg-QLP-2

Subject: DR drill — locker access flow

Team,

Thursday's drill covers the Tumblevault laundry-locker access flow. We simulate a full outage of the badge gateway and fail over to manual unlock mode. Ops will time the cutover; target is under ten minutes. If the fallback console prompts you, use the recovery passphrase below.

unlock words, yawig-kagef: gordor-holvan-ulaael-pramir-ulaiel-tamdor